An Intimate Festival Launch
Nusa Dua, 4 July 2016… Jazz Market by the Sea 2016 (JM 2016) really knows how to entertain the jazz community, both local and national. Various culture-themed activities will be held during this 6th annual event, taking place 19-21 August at Taman Bhagawan, Tanjung Benoa – Nusa Dua, Bali.
“It is our mission to showcase Indonesian heritage during each event. This year our theme is Clothing the Nation –featuring textiles especially endek from Klungkung, gringsing from Tenganan and batik from Java,” says Astari Siswanto, Founder of JM 2016.
The conference invited an array of musicians that will perform in the JM 2016 among them Lilo from KLA Project, John from White Shoes and the Couples Company, Endah representing the first time ever collaboration of Dialog Dini Hari and Endah n Rhesa (DDHEAR), Dira from Dira Bongs, and Erik Sondhy.
Endah, vocalist of DDHEAR, stated “As DDHEAR was born in Bali, our playing at the 6th Jazz market is like coming home.”
Dwiki Darmawan, a member of Krakatau Reunion, also shared his experience performing at Jazz Market two years ago, he says, “It is in one of the top 5 best events from the 70 countries that I have had the pleasure of performing in. It was one of the best in terms of content, organization, and an excellent concept that infuses Indonesian culture with jazz music, on the beach.”
“We bring a line up suited for all ages– teenagers, family and the nostalgic 90s generation,” mentions Jappy Sanger, the Co-founder of Jazz Market.
Lilo, the guitarist from KLA project, the headliner of this year’s festival, said,” The idealism of the festival, has inspired me to create a unique composition for KLA Project performance during the festival.”
